Last night the New Beverly in Hollywood, CA ran a double feature of Fred Dekker's The Monster Squad and Night of the Creeps. Fred Dekker was present for a between show Q&A. Shane Black was also there but wasn't involved in the interview. On a side note, while waiting in line for the men's room Seth Green was talking to the box office cashier. I didn't know the guy was a midget. The Beverly sold out, I know it had sold out many shows before but this was the first time I was ever there when it did. The Bev was able to acquire a 35mm print of Monster Squad. When the American Cinematheque ran it last July they ran a projection of the DVD. This was the first time I saw it on film since opening day back in '87; it looked great. Also, Night of the Creeps was presented in 35mm and the print looked great. -Dekker hates Robocop 3.

-For Night of the Creeps, he prefers the alternate ending and not the theatrical ending.

-He says he's over the horror genre. We've seen everything so there really isn't anything left to be afraid of. He's not too keen on remakes. He doesn't really feel the need to turn the Squad into a tv series, make a sequel or remake it. It's been done, move on. He thinks Zach Snyder is a talented and terrific filmmaker but did we really need Dawn of the Dead. He said more people are aware of that then Romero's original classic.

-He has a number of projects in the works. He's producing a tv pilot "The Genie Chronicles" and will be directing a drama, something music related.

-He mentioned that when the film opened it was normal to jump in a limo and go to theatres opening weekend to check out business. Squad was depressing. They never did it for Creeps. The last several screenings of the Squad was very moving for him. He compared the Beverly audience to the Alamo audience, the only difference was you could drink there. Of course, someone in the aud raises a beer to much applause.

-Fred said Night of the Creeps is being dragged by Sony, hence no DVD release. If we want it on DVD, send a letter to Sony Pictures Home Entertainment with a brick. After receiving all those bricks they have to release it to stop the deliveries. After seeing the film, I gotta wonder if the music rights issues is the reason for the hold up. There are a number of classic songs in there.

-If people were wondering why Shane Black wasn't on the DVD it was because he never returned his phone calls.

-Lionsgate wants to do a Blu-ray release of the film. They just weren't sure if anyone would want it because they already released a full bells and whistles version on DVD. The plan is to have a running video commentary with Fred Dekker and Shane Black. It's on the table, they just have to sign the deal.
